Wonderful inner-Melbourne spot, on the banks of the Yarra - VERY reasonably priced, and you can buy a bag of food for the animals at minimal charge. The Farm has all the normal farmyard animals you would expect and room to feed them, touch them and even watch the cow being milked. Every time we go our son has to... More
